Buddy, a preschool-aged Tyrannosaurus Rex, and his family ride the Dinosaur Train to learn about all kinds of dinosaurs in different eras. 🎬 Dinosaur Train Season 1 — Episode Guide

E1
Valley of the Stygimolochs
2009-09-07
Buddy wonders if he’ll grow horns when he gets older, so Mrs. Pteranodon takes him to visit some dinosaurs called Stygimoloch, who have really impressive horns.
E2
Tiny Loves Fish
2009-09-07
After Mr. Pteranodon teaches the kids his fishing method, Buddy and Tiny work together as a team to catch fish in the Big Pond.
E3
The Call of the Wild Corythosaurus
2009-09-08
The family surprises Mom for her birthday with a trip to a concert given by Cory and her family of Corythosaurus, who play music through the crests on their heads.
E4
Triceratops for Lunch
2009-09-08
Our Pteranodon family eats lunch with their friend Tank Triceratops and discovers that he and his family are all plant-eaters, with great leaf-eating teeth and giant appetites!
E5
Beating the Heat
2009-09-09
Buddy and Tiny travel to the Jurassic to make a new friend, Morris Stegosaurus, and discover how this huge dinosaur keeps cool in the heat.
E6
Flowers for Mom
2009-09-09
The kids go to the Big Pond to look for flowers to give to Mom on her special Mothers Day. They find many different flowers while following a very busy bee.
E7
I'm a T. Rex!
2009-09-10
Buddy travels to Rexville on the Dinosaur Train and meets Delores Tyrannosaurus and her daughter Annie. When he sees that he shares all the same features, Buddy learns that he is a Tyrannosaurus rex!
E8
Ned the Quadruped
2009-09-10
Buddy and Tiny tour the Dinosaur Train and earn their Junior Conductor hats while their friend Ned, a four-legged, long-necked Brachiosaurus and regular Train rider, tags along.
E9
One Smart Dinosaur
2009-09-11
Buddy and Tiny want to test their memory, so they ride the Dinosaur Train and spend some time with the Conductor, since he’s a Troodon with a great memory. The kids get to meet the Conductor’s mom, Mrs. Conductor.
E10
Petey the Peteinosaurus
2009-09-11
Buddy and Tiny ride the Dinosaur Train to meet Petey Peteinosaurus, a “flying lizard,” who is fun, funny, and friendly, and has some features similar to both Buddy and Tiny!
E11
Fast Friends
2009-09-17
Buddy, Tiny, and Mom ride the Dinosaur Train to meet Oren and Ollie Ornithomimus, some of the fastest dinosaurs ever! The kids love meeting the fast-moving and fast-talking twins.
E12
T. Rex Teeth
2009-09-17
When Buddy loses a tooth, Mom takes him to Rexville to ask his Tyrannosaurus friends all about T. rex teeth. They explain that he’ll grow new teeth to replace the old ones.
E13
Now with Feathers!
2009-09-18
Dad gives Tiny and Buddy a mystery feather and the kids become “detectives,” riding the Dinosaur Train to meet Valerie Velociraptor, who shows the kids what it’s like to be covered with beautiful feathers.
E14
A Frill a Minute
2009-09-18
The kids help Tank Triceratops overcome his awkwardness with having a huge head by showing him how cool and amazing his features are, especially his frill.
E15
One Big Dinosaur
2009-09-21
Tiny and Buddy visit a dinosaur family called Argentinosaurus, some of the biggest land creatures ever! The kids find out there are great things about being really big, and that it’s also great being their own size.
E16
Play Date with Annie
2009-09-21
Buddy is excited that his friend Annie Tyrannosaurus is coming to the Pteranodon nest to visit and play. After Tiny feels left out, Buddy and Annie show her that they can all be friends!
E17
Armored Like an Ankylosaurus
2009-09-22
The kids travel on the Dinosaur Train with Mr. Pteranodon to see his hero, Hank Ankylosaurus, play a game of Dinoball. Afterwards, they even get to play with Hank and learn what it’s like to be a dinosaur that is covered with armored plates and has a mighty club for a tail.
E18
Campout!
2009-09-22
Our Pteranodon family goes to the Big Pond for their first overnight camp out and meets a small frog with a big voice!
E19
Laura the Giganotosaurus
2009-09-29
Buddy spends time with Laura Giganotosaurus, a large dinosaur who always rides the Dinosaur Train and, like Buddy, is a three-toed theropod! Buddy also discovers that Laura is an avid bird-watcher.
E20
Dinosaur Poop!
2009-09-29
Buddy and Tiny learn that all creatures poop, even really big dinosaurs.
